NCover有一个属性 IgnoreFromCoverage 允许在代码覆盖率分析期间将代码标记为排除。有没有办法使用 VSTS 代码覆盖工具来做到这一点?

明显的用途是自动属性 ​​getter 和 setter,非明显的用途可能是 R# equals 实现生成的代码或 ORM 生成的代码。

有帮助吗?

解决方案

对于 Visual Studio 2010,您可以使用 ExcludeFromCodeCoverage 属性。您可以将该属性应用于整个类或类中的方法。看 微软软件定义网络 了解更多信息。

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top